I have this strange pebbled effect on a mesh I was modelling. Don't know where it came from or how to get rid of it. See image. This is supposed to be a smooth curved surface. No bump maps or anything else is applied, except for color. I've tried different UV mapping choices, no change. The only thing that changes it is I specify faceted in my material, but that is not what I want.

 

Anybody recognize what this is? What setting is this, or how can I turn it off?

Hi Jeff,

 

I think it’s topology problem. Select vertexes by numeric with 2 or less edges, if there is such delete them. Also select all vertexes and weld them with low settings wale  (somethink like 0.1 or 0.01, truy few values). And Normal modifier with Unify normals on.

 

Maybe STL Check modifier will tell you what's wrong.
